Japanese in Penang
The Japanese Forces had invaded Penang in 1941. In 1951, there were 2 young cousins who were in contact - Mazalifah Aziz residing in Penang and Abdul Rashid Mohd Yusope, her Malacca cousin who was attending Malay College, Kuala Kangsar.

Abdul Rashid Mohd Yusope's ACS School Leaving Certificate, 6 June 1951. Where did he go to study in 1951? MCKK
Abdul Rashid Mohd Yusope Malay College School Leaving Certificate, 9 November 1951. He was at Malay College for 9 months. Where did he go after Nov 1951? England.
How long was he in England? 2 years. For what? He attended the Malayan Teachers' Training College at Kirkby, near Liverpool, England.

Haji Aziz bin Mohd Ibrahim (Radical)
Abdul Aziz bin Ibrahim was a publisher in Jelutong, Penang. What was the name of his publishing company? He was the son-in-law of the UMNO President.* He belonged to the Radical party. Both he and wife lost the election.
The Singapore Free Press, 5 December 1952, page 4. "Backing, Not Personality, Will Bring in the Votes." http://bit.ly/w0SzGy
1st UMNO President was Dato Onn Jaafar.
2nd UMNO President was Tunku Abdul Rahman
*Dato Onn Jaafar left UMNO in August 1951 to form the Independence of Malaya Party (IMP). Tunku Abdul Rahman took over as the 2nd UMNO President.
The Singapore Free Press, 5 December 1952, page 4. "Backing, Not Personality, Will Bring in the Votes." http://bit.ly/w0SzGy
Dr S Mohd Baboo (UMNO-Muslim) and Mr Aziz Ibrahim (Radical). Both were defeated last year, Dr Baboo in Kelawei Ward and Mr Ibrahim in Jelutong. Dr Baboo is a former Government medical officer now in private practice, while Mr Ibrahim is a publisher whose wife contested unsuccessfully for UMNO last year.
